Calculated on the pre-tax subtotal — what the printing itself costs, before GST, PST or shipping. Those are not ours to earn on, so we do not pay a commission on them either.
We pay out monthly once your balance has reached $100. Under that it simply rolls into next month rather than disappearing.

You get a code and a link. Anyone who arrives through it is attached to you from that point on — not just for their first order.
Designers and studios whose clients need printing. Makers and small brands. Event and community organisers. Anyone whose audience already asks them where to get things printed.
Coupon and deal-aggregator sites, bulk email lists, or anything that works by volume rather than trust. We review every application by hand, and we care more about who is doing the recommending than how many people hear it.

Affiliates share a link and earn a flat percentage — light-touch, open to anyone we approve. Being a rep is a much closer relationship: a handful of people who actively bring in and look after business clients, on a different and longer-running arrangement.
E-transfer, monthly, once your balance clears $100. You will be able to see what you have earned in your account.
No — self-referral does not earn commission. If you print with us yourself and do it regularly, a commercial account will serve you far better than 5% would.
No. A designer with forty clients who trust them is worth considerably more to us than an account with forty thousand followers who do not.
